Son of Luigi and Corina, Italian immigrants, Paulo Menotti Del Picchia was born in the city of São Paulo on March 20, 1892. At the age of five, he went to live inland, in the city of Itapira, which ended up becoming important in the author's history. It was to her that Menotti returned, recently graduated in Law, after studying in Campinas and in the capital.
There he worked as a lawyer and journalist, having directed the newspaper city of itapira and founded The Scream. It was also there that he wrote the poems moisés It is Juca Mulatto, major milestones in his career. […]
In 1920, Menotti returned to São Paulo to take over the direction of the newspaper The Gazette. In the same year, he founded the magazine Paper and Ink, with Oswald de Andrade, and released masks, one of his most famous works. At the São Paulo Mail, under the pseudonym “Hélios”, he began to make heated defenses of modernism.
Already a member of the Grupo dos Cinco, Menotti participated intensely in the organization of the Art Week Moderna, having been responsible for opening the second night of the event, the most tumultuous and important of all.
Throughout his life, Menotti Del Picchia received important honors. In 1943, he became immortal of the Brazilian Academy of Letters (ABL); in 1960, he won the Jabuti Prize for Poetry; in 1982, he was proclaimed the fourth Prince of Brazilian Poets; in 1987, his beloved Itapira presented him with Casa Menotti Del Picchia.
the author of Republic of the United States of Brazil died on August 23, 1988, aged 96, in the city of São Paulo. He left seven children and countless readers and admirers.
